Solatube
1230 Fairview Ave SE
Salem, OR 97302
Solatube, based in Salem, OR, specializes in innovative daylighting solutions for residential and commercial spaces.
With a focus on sustainability and energy efficiency, Solatube offers products that harness natural light to brighten interiors and reduce reliance on artificial lighting.
Generated from their business information
Also at this address
See a problem?